Hello,

in the readme of some mods i read that i could/should use fomm to change the load order of the mods and that i could use fomm as a louncher.

I took a look at it but was not able to figure out how to change the load order. For Oblivion you could just move the mods up or down in the list. I could not find something similar in fomm.

Does anyone know how this works?

Thank you!

Drag and drop. Hold the mouse down over the mod you want to move, drag it where you want it and let go.

If fallout 3 behaves like oblivion, mod load order is not based on plugins.txt; it's based on the last modified timestamp of the esp. plugins.txt was mearly a list of which plugins to load. (I haven't actually checked what fallout does, so if you know something that I don't let me know. :P)
 
You can simply move them in Fomm up and down, just by dragging them.
The orginal datalauncher however is stupid and will load them in alphabetical order again as soon as you use it. You can simply rename the mods, like: aa no god mode vats, ab mod-x
this way the fallout launcher will load them your desired way. or you use fomm everytime you want to play f3
